The idea of artificial companions is not entirely new. Early chatbots like ELIZA and PARRY laid foundational groundwork for conversational AI. However, the advent of more sophisticated graphics and deep learning technologies has allowed for the creation of AI girls that are not only conversational partners but also visually appealing entities. Initially, these AI girls appeared in niche online communities and virtual worlds, gaining popularity through anime-inspired designs and customizable features.

Normativas y requisitos legales para la gestión de residuos peligrosos

Marco legal nacional e internacional

La gestión de residuos peligrosos en España está regulada por la Ley 22/2011 de Residuos y Suelos Contaminados, que establece los principios y obligaciones para su manejo adecuado. A nivel internacional, el Convenio de Basilea regula el movimiento transfronterizo de residuos peligrosos, garantizando su transporte seguro y responsable.

Obligaciones de las empresas

Las empresas que generan residuos peligrosos deben cumplir con requisitos específicos, como la identificación, clasificación, almacenamiento adecuado, documentación, transporte autorizado y tratamiento en instalaciones homologadas. Además, deben elaborar planes de gestión y reportar sus actividades a las autoridades ambientales.
